## Snapshot Testing at Marloweave

Our Glintframe UI components are snapshot-tested on every merge. Never approve diffs blindly; review each pixel change against the design ledger. Baselines live in an encrypted archive maintained by the Fernbrook tooling squad. To regenerate baselines locally, decrypt the archive with the recovery passphrase below.

vault phrase of hahop-hawef = ralael-ralath-aldok

## Changelog — TaxCache 4.2.0

Changed defaults. Cache TTL for tax-rate lookups dropped from 24h to 1h after the Veldane rate-change incident. Stale-while-revalidate is now on by default. Negative lookups cached 5m instead of never. Impact: higher upstream query volume to the Ratefeed service; watch its latency panel for the first 48h after deploy. Rollback is a config revert, no code change. New defaults shipping with this release are listed below.

deployment values, kajep-kageg:
[praix]
host = praix.paliqcorp.corp
user = praix_svc
database = praix_prod

The Veltrane Components contract expires end of Q3. Unit costs rose 4% year-on-year; volume rebates offset roughly half. Service levels met targets in 10 of 12 months. Alternatives (Korrin Fabrication, Ostwell Parts) quoted higher on comparable terms. Recommendation: renew for 24 months with a capped escalation clause and quarterly performance reviews. Legal has cleared the draft. Approval needed from all department heads by Friday. The renewal decision connects directly to our confidential sourcing strategy, summarised below.

management briefing: Project Ulavan slips by two quarters because of the staffing delay.

Handover note — Crumbwheel order cutoffs.

Welcome aboard. The bakery cutoff rule in Crumbwheel closes same-day orders at 14:00 local to each storefront, not UTC — this has bitten us twice. Holiday overrides live in the calendar service and take precedence silently, so always check there first when a cutoff looks wrong. To unlock the calendar service's admin console after a restart, enter the recovery passphrase below.

vault phrase of bagap-bahaf = silion-pelox-sorox-casdor-quenwyn-fraax-eliox-praael-kelion-quenvan-kasox-rusael-norius-belvan